ABOUT Edwin D. Fleming

Joined Burch & Cracchiolo in 1984

A native of Arizona, Ed Fleming began working with Burch & Cracchiolo as a law clerk while still in law school and, through nearly 30 years with the firm, Ed has proven to be one of the top trial lawyers and business minds in Arizona. Ed is a peer review rated AV® Preeminent 5.0 out of 5 attorney by Martindale-Hubbell and is listed in the 2011 edition of Southwest Super Lawyers. He currently serves on the Firm's Executive Committee.

Ed's undergraduate degree in Business Administration, with an emphasis in finance and economics, along with his active management role in a family business, allows him to relate to his business clients' needs and concerns. He is a trusted advisor to a host of business clients who turn to him for advice and counsel on matters from day-to-day transactions to dispute resolution. While Ed is a believer in conflict resolution through methods other than costly trials, he is known to be a relentless advocate for his clients in situations where trial is necessary or inevitable.

As a litigator, Ed represents both plaintiffs and defendants in complicated commercial disputes. He has successfully prosecuted and defended professionals, including lawyers and accountants, in dozens of cases and represented multiple clients in cases involving financial fraud and securities issues. His diverse experience includes shareholder derivative actions, civil employment litigation, and state and federal racketeering claims.

Ed has extensive experience in real estate litigation matters, including claims brought by bank and lending institutions against real estate developers and contractors, as well as claims made by and against general contractors and subcontractors.
